我打算在我的项目中使用MySQL的Master(Active-Active)架构。
在我的项目中,我有两个活动站点和灾难站点。在主动站点上,我们使用了2个MySQL数据库服务器-一个是主-主动,另一个是主-被动,它将数据复制到灾难站点。主动主机也复制到被动主机。所有三个应用服务器都只在主服务器上运行。
现在,我计划使用主被动作为主主动。现在,活动站点将有两个主服务器处于活动状态,一个应用服务器将在一个主服务器上写入活动状态,另两个应用服务器将在第二个主服务器上写入活动状态。
如果你能告诉我使用这个建筑的利弊,那就太好了。可能会出现什么问题,有什么补救措施?
仅供参考。。会话粘性也用于从web服务器到应用程序服务器。
谢谢,
普拉山特古普塔

最佳答案

你想达到什么目的?提高可用性?表演?
您计划如何管理从应用服务器到数据库实例的连接?浮动IP地址?静态映射?故障转移呢?您有什么监视措施来测量主节点的可用性?复制延迟?

关于mysql - MySQL Master(主动)-Master(主动)复制,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/12580834/

10-11 23:47